International Camps
Interested in joining the celebration of 100 years of International Girl Guiding and Girl Scouting? Groups/troops can check out these spectacular events for Girl Guides, Girl Scouts and volunteers happening all over the world. For applications that require the International Commissioners stamp or questions, please email globalgirlscouting@girlscouts.org.
Girls can also apply through destinations to attend the Girl Guiding UK Centenary Camp this summer.

These 2010 Centenary Camps are available for groop/troop travel. For information regarding registration and cost, please go to the Web sites of the Camp for more detailed information. Adult Leaders/Advisors must accompany girls. Please adhere to your council's requirements for approval for troop/groop international trips.
